Output d32e2302e2aade85ba0613a92b065760fc1a581996c430f5939f9facb420d82b:65

value
692351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93d021e46add553c10648ddfe46b4d850339a5d6 OP_EQUAL
address
3FAab2yimaqcfZCdDHamKufsbLjdpqBbvY
transaction
d32e2302e2aade85ba0613a92b065760fc1a581996c430f5939f9facb420d82b
spent
true